What are some common challenges an associate consultant might face when transitioning from academia to consulting?

Associate Consultants often find the pace and client-focused nature of consulting to be markedly different from academic environments. Adapting to tight project deadlines, managing multiple stakeholders with differing expectations, and quickly learning to communicate complex findings in a clear, actionable way are typical challenges. However, most firms provide robust training, mentorship programs, and collaborative team structures to help new hires bridge this gap and succeed early in their consulting careers.

What is an associate consultant?

An Associate Consultant is an entry-level professional in a consulting firm who supports senior consultants and project managers in analyzing data, conducting research, preparing reports, and delivering insights to clients. They typically work as part of a team to help organizations solve business problems and improve their operations. Associate Consultants gain exposure to various industries and often have opportunities for advancement as they develop their skills and experience.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an associate consultant,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Associate Consultant, you need strong analytical abilities, problem-solving skills, and a relevant bachelor’s degree, often in business, engineering, or a related field. Familiarity with data analysis tools like Excel, PowerPoint, and sometimes specialized software such as Tableau or SQL, is typically required. Outstanding communication, teamwork, and adaptability make someone stand out in this client-facing role. These skills and qualities are vital for delivering insightful recommendations, building client trust, and succeeding in dynamic project environments.

What does an associate consulting do?

An associate in consulting typically supports project teams by conducting research, analyzing data, preparing reports, and assisting with client presentations. They often work under the supervision of senior consultants and develop skills in problem-solving, communication, and industry-specific tools. The role may require strong analytical abilities and proficiency in software like Excel or PowerPoint.
